Economic operation of electric energy generating systems is one of the prevailing problems in energy systems. In this paper, a new method called the Backtracking Search Optimization Algorithm (BSA) is proposed for solving the optimal power flow problem. This method is tested for 16 different cases on the IEEE 30-bus, IEEE 57-bus, and IEEE 118-bus test systems. In addition to the traditional generating fuel cost, multi-fuels options, valve-point effect and other complexities have been considered. Furthermore, different objectives such as voltage profile improvement, voltage stability enhancement and emission reduction are considered. The obtained results are compared with those obtained using some well-known optimization algorithms. This comparison highlights the effectiveness of the BSA method for solving different OPF problems with complicated and non-smooth objective functions.
